Fledborough Viaduct – River Trent Viaduct loop from Gainsborough Central

04:20

70.3km

220m

Cycling

Moderate bike ride. Good fitness required. Mostly paved surfaces. Suitable for all skill levels.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.

North Leverton Windmill

Highlight • Monument

Oldest working million England.
Open to public most days. Great views from top. Can buy flour and homemade honey worth a visit.
